Getting Started
TEST THE MAIN BOARD
- Connect the USB Cable to the Micro-USB port on the Main Board and a USB power source.
- Ensure your M162 main board boots up correctly. When powered on. the LED (D1) will blink twice. The display will then go through two splash screens and enter into a state similar to the below illustration.
- The values of the numbers are random. Please ignore them and just ensure the display is normal.
If your M162 main board does not power up. or powers up with a blank screen. please contact us at [email protected]. Do not solder any parts onto the board if you encounter any issues as this will void the warranty.

Verify Voltages
- Apply 5V power supply via the micro-USEI connector on the analog board.
- Spot check the voltages on the board at the test points labeled to ensure they measure to the voltages in the chart below.

Quick Test
- Attach the main board to the analog board
- Apply power supply via the micro-USEI connector on the analog board and slide the power switch to ON position.
- Once the device starts up. hold down RU. button to bring up the menu. Select the ‘Default’ option to set all the parameters to their default values
- Test measurement with the provided resistors (10 & 1140). capacitor (0.10F). and inductor ilmH). or with your own com-ponents.
Note: The provided resistors are 1% tolerance. The capacitor and inductor tolerance can be 10% or higher. If the measured values are away from their labeled value they might not reflect a problem of the meter. Further confirmation is required.
